29 CFR 1910.179(n)(4)(i): The upper limit switch of each hoist was not tried out under no load, at the beginning of each operator's shift: (a) Production - On December 1, 2017, the employer did not ensure that the Cleveland Tramrail 3 ton crane's upper hoist limit switch was tried out at the beginning of each operator's shift. In accordance with the requirements of 29 CFR 1903.19(d), abatement certification is required for this violation (using the CERTIFICATION OF CORRECTIVE ACTION WORKSHEET), and in addition, documentation demonstrating that abatement is complete and must be included with your certification. This documentation may include, but is not limited to, evidence of the purchase, or repair of the equipment, photographic or video evidence of abatement, or other written records.

29 CFR 1910.179(j)(2)(iii): Monthly inspections of hooks, with a certification record which includes the date of inspection, the signature of the person who performed the inspection and the serial number, or other identifier, of the hook inspected, were not performed: (a)Production - On December 1, 2017, the employer did not conduct a monthly inspection of the Cleveland Tramrail 3 ton crane's hooks. The monthly inspection shall include a certification record which identifies the date of inspection, the signature of the person who performed the inspection and the serial number, or other identifier of the hook being inspected. In accordance with 29 CFR 1903.19(c), abatement certification is required for this violation (using the CERTIFICATION OF CORRECTIVE ACTION WORKSHEET).

29 CFR 1910.179(j)(2)(iv): Monthly inspections of hoist chains, with a certification record which includes the date of inspection, the signature of the person who performed the inspection and an identifier of the chain which was inspected, were not performed: (a) Production - On December 1, 2017, the employer did not conduct a monthly inspection of the Cleveland Tramrail 3 ton crane's hoist chains. The monthly inspection shall include a certification record which identifies the date of inspection, the signature of the person who performed the inspection and the serial number, or other identifier of the chain being inspected. In accordance with 29 CFR 1903.19(c), abatement certification is required for this violation (using the CERTIFICATION OF CORRECTIVE ACTION WORKSHEET).
